Transaction adb88064970121fe4e9516e2c16d314e8d1c5e179dce25d9aa07ea76b4589e70

3 Input
1 Outputs
  • adb88064970121fe4e9516e2c16d314e8d1c5e179dce25d9aa07ea76b4589e70:0
  • value  151821316
    address  35L2bwVK1UgcZoq5ZoqFEYp5B4Jmd4KsdL